Types of Power Tools
Power tools are classified based upon their operational system, and comprehending these types can facilitate much better selection and usage of tools. Here are some common classifications:

Electric tools use electrical energy to operate. They can be categorized as:
Corded Power Tools: Tools that require a direct connection to the power outlet, such as circular saws, drills, and sanders. These offer limitless run time but are limited by cable length.

2. Air-Powered Tools
These tools run on compressed air, especially in commercial settings. Common examples include pneumatic nailers, impact wrenches, and spray guns.

While power tools provide numerous advantages, they also posture dangers if not used correctly. Here are crucial safety suggestions to think about:

A: Corded tools require a direct connection to a power source, supplying endless run time however minimal variety. Cordless tools provide portability and benefit but rely on battery life and recharging.
Q2: How do I maintain my power tools?
A: Regular upkeep includes cleansing, looking for damaged parts, and lubricating moving parts. Furthermore, follow the producer's directions for battery care and storage.
Q3: What safety gear do I require for power tool usage?
A: Essential security gear includes security goggles, ear security, gloves, and respiratory masks for dust control.
Q4: Can I use power tools inside?
A: Yes, however make sure sufficient ventilation and usage dust collection systems where applicable to minimize risks.
Q5: What should I do if my power tool breakdowns?
A: Stop utilizing the tool right away, disconnect it, and speak with the user handbook for troubleshooting suggestions. If essential, look for professional repair assistance.
